Nike ushers in 2019 with its brand new performance-focused runner: the Air VaporMax 2019. While already previewed a few times in more vibrant colorways, the first few colors for the new year appear to be landing now, starting with this stunning Olive edition.
The fully synthetic 2019 upper is splashed with shades of Olive green — toebox and rear ankle receive a medium shade while the “taped seams” encircle the upper in a dark tone. Naturally to complement the “military”-esque palette, hits of bright orange can be found along the rear counter and heel tab. Lastly, the all-air VM sole is adorned in a semi-translucent grey to match the tongue.
The Olive edition will be available at Nike.com and retailers like Size?, where you can pick up your pair for £165 GBP (approx. $210 USD).
